浅谈javascript属性onresize


Posted in Javascript onApril 20, 2015

浅谈javascript属性onresize

//获取屏幕宽度并动态赋值  
var winWidth = 0;
var winHeight = 0;
function findDimensions() //函数:获取尺寸
{
//获取窗口宽度
if (window.innerWidth)
winWidth = window.innerWidth;
else if ((document.body) && (document.body.clientWidth))
winWidth = document.body.clientWidth;
//获取窗口高度
if (window.innerHeight)
winHeight = window.innerHeight;
else if ((document.body) && (document.body.clientHeight))
winHeight = document.body.clientHeight;
//通过深入Document内部对body进行检测,获取窗口大小
if (document.documentElement && document.documentElement.clientHeight && document.documentElement.clientWidth)
{
winHeight = document.documentElement.clientHeight;
winWidth = document.documentElement.clientWidth;
}
//结果输出至两个文本框

$("body").height(winHeight)
$("body").width(winWidth)
}

findDimensions();
//调用函数,获取数值
window.onresize=findDimensions;
//-->

只有我要对屏幕大小进行操作的时候才想起原来还有个对屏幕操作的属性

onresize 事件会在窗口或框架被调整大小时发生。

以上所述就是本文的全部内容了,希望大家能够喜欢。

Javascript 相关文章推荐
一个原生的用户等级的进度条
Jul 03 Javascript
JavaScript高级程序设计(第3版)学习笔记5 js语句
Oct 11 Javascript
js日期对象兼容性的处理方法
Jan 28 Javascript
使用jQuery的ajax方法向服务器发出get和post请求的方法
Jan 13 Javascript
MUI实现上拉加载和下拉刷新效果
Jun 30 Javascript
JS中Object对象的原型概念基础
Jan 29 Javascript
Redux实现组合计数器的示例代码
Jul 04 Javascript
JavaScript中为事件指定处理程序的五种方式分析
Jul 27 Javascript
vue地址栏直接输入路由无效问题的解决
Nov 15 Javascript
js中offset,client , scroll 三大元素知识点总结
Sep 11 Javascript
在博客园博文中添加自定义右键菜单的方法详解
Feb 05 Javascript
vue移动端写的拖拽功能示例代码
Sep 09 Javascript
jquery代码实现简单的随机图片瀑布流效果
Apr 20 #Javascript
被遗忘的javascript的slice() 方法
Apr 20 #Javascript
JavaScript Window浏览器对象模型方法与属性汇总
Apr 20 #Javascript
分享10个原生JavaScript技巧
Apr 20 #Javascript
JQuery限制复选框checkbox可选中个数的方法
Apr 20 #Javascript
js插件YprogressBar实现漂亮的进度条效果
Apr 20 #Javascript
浅谈javascript中call()、apply()、bind()的用法
Apr 20 #Javascript
You might like
mysql建立外键
2006/11/25 PHP
PHP 作用域解析运算符(::)
2010/07/27 PHP
php获取当前页面完整URL地址
2015/12/30 PHP
最新28个很棒的jQuery 教程
2011/05/28 Javascript
IE不支持getElementsByClassName最终完美解决方案
2012/12/17 Javascript
JS实现支持多选的遍历下拉列表代码
2015/08/20 Javascript
基于jQuery实现带动画效果超炫酷的弹出对话框(附源码下载)
2016/02/22 Javascript
Bootstrap框架的学习教程详解(二)
2016/10/18 Javascript
React Native预设占位placeholder的使用
2017/09/28 Javascript
js装饰设计模式学习心得
2018/02/17 Javascript
Vue.JS实现垂直方向展开、收缩不定高度模块的JS组件
2018/06/19 Javascript
js实现左右两侧浮动广告
2018/07/09 Javascript
electron实现qq快捷登录的方法示例
2018/10/22 Javascript
Vuex 模块化使用详解
2019/07/31 Javascript
[43:14]Liquid vs Optic 2018国际邀请赛淘汰赛BO3 第二场 8.21
2018/08/22 DOTA
python中使用pyhook实现键盘监控的例子
2014/07/18 Python
python批量同步web服务器代码核心程序
2014/09/01 Python
Django权限机制实现代码详解
2018/02/05 Python
python实现冒泡排序算法的两种方法
2018/03/10 Python
Python OpenCV处理图像之图像像素点操作
2018/07/10 Python
Sanic框架基于类的视图用法示例
2018/07/18 Python
Python图像处理之图像的读取、显示与保存操作【测试可用】
2019/01/04 Python
树莓派3 搭建 django 服务器的实例
2019/08/29 Python
使用Pytorch来拟合函数方式
2020/01/14 Python
python新手学习使用库
2020/06/11 Python
Django中ORM的基本使用教程
2020/12/22 Python
英国领先的鞋类零售商:Shoe Zone
2018/12/13 全球购物
香港彩色隐形眼镜在线商店:Stunninglens(全球免费送货)
2019/05/10 全球购物
香港中原电器网上商店:Chung Yuen
2019/06/26 全球购物
娇韵诗俄罗斯官方网站:Clarins俄罗斯
2020/10/03 全球购物
将n个数按输入顺序的逆序排列,用函数实现
2012/11/14 面试题
行政部主管岗位职责
2013/12/28 职场文书
面试感谢信范文
2015/01/22 职场文书
客房服务员岗位职责
2015/02/09 职场文书
详解Python描述符的工作原理
2021/06/11 Python
聊聊基于pytorch实现Resnet对本地数据集的训练问题
2022/03/25 Python